Gearbox Software has officially announced the release date for Borderlands 4. During the recent State of Play presentation, Gearbox president Randy Pitchford revealed that the game will launch on September 23, 2025. To mark the occasion, a new trailer showcasing exciting gameplay features was unveiled.
A standout feature in the trailer is the addition of a grappling hook, adding a new dimension to traversal and combat. However, fans can rest assured that the signature *Borderlands* blend of over-the-top weaponry, explosive action, and chaotic mayhem remains a core element.Further celebrating the announcement, Gearbox announced a dedicated Borderlands 4 State of Play presentation scheduled for this spring. This special showcase will delve deeper into the gameplay mechanics and, of course, reveal even more of the game's arsenal of weaponry.
While specific story details remain under wraps, the lead writer has hinted at a potential shift away from the previous game's reliance on "toilet humor." Whether Borderlands 4 will adopt a more mature tone remains to be seen.
